With heavy hearts, we announce the passing of Larry Troutner on February 8, 2025. Larry was a beloved member of our community, known for his kindness, generosity, and dedication. He was born on January 2nd, 1941, and throughout his life, he touched many hearts with his empathy and compassion. After 59 years in Ohio and 37 years of service to public education, Larry retired to Lady Lake, FL in The Villages. Larry excelled academically and professionally, earning respect and admiration in his career. Larry earned his bachelor's degree in education from North Central College, a Master's degree in psychology from Defiance College and a EdS degree from Kent State. He was passionate about his hobbies including fixing anything, working on computers and travel, along with sharing his adventures with friends and family. Through the years, Larry was also deeply involved in Hope Lutheran Church and with his family, leaving a legacy of friendship and giving. He is survived by his spouse of almost 55 years, Anita (Berger), his children, Mike (Ann) Troutner, Amy (Kevin) Baker, Paula (Marcus) Shuter and Eric (Stephanie) Troutner, and his grandchildren, Tara and Ryan Baker, Ross Troutner, Jordan Shuter, and Caroline Troutner. He was preceded in death by his parents Ruby and Harry Troutner, sister Sharon Edwards and granddaughter Shelby(Troutner) Blue. Thank you to all the caregiver's that assisted Larry during the last few months of his life, he truly enjoyed the time spent with each of you. A celebration of Larry's life will be held on Saturday, March 8th, 10:30am at Hope Lutheran Church, in The Villages.
